macos - 升级到 OS X Mavericks 后 Drush 坏了

标签 macos mamp drush

从 OSX 10.8 (Mountain Lion) 升级到 OSX 10.9 (Mavericks) 后,Drush 崩溃了。我有 MAMP。

我调用 drush 时的错误信息:

Could not open input file: /usr/lib/php/pear/drush/drush.php

我已将以下内容放入 .bash_profile

export PATH="/Applications/MAMP/Library/bin:/Applications/MAMP/bin/php5.3.20/bin:$PATH"

有什么想法吗?

最佳答案

OSX Mavericks 没有 PEAR(你的 Drush 可能也不见了)。

安装 PEAR -

sudo php -d detect_unicode=0 /usr/lib/php/install-pear-nozlib.phar

安装 Drush -

sudo pear channel-discover pear.drush.org
sudo pear install drush/drush

以 root 身份运行 Drush,以便 Drush 安装 Console::Getopt 等。

sudo drush help

关于macos - 升级到 OS X Mavericks 后 Drush 坏了,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/19819485/

相关文章:

python - 如何在mac终端中设置环境变量并让python脚本有效地选择变量?

macos - MAMP 持续无响应故障排除

macos - Drush 无法在 MAMP 上连接到 MySQL?

drupal - 是否可以使用 Drush 使 Drupal 站点脱机?

MYSQL 不再通过 MAMP 在 Mac 上启动

docker - 为什么我无法执行vendor/bin/drush(文件没有执行权限)

objective-c - 是否可以提交给Mac App Store(OsX Mavericks除外)进行下载

swift - NSCollectionViewItem 从不实例化

linux - OSX sed : how to use the escape character in the second field of a `s` operation?

mysql - 在 MAMP 堆栈上运行的 CodeIgniter 中没有选择数据库错误